一、AI任务执行框架的技术演进与核心价值
传统自动化工具依赖硬编码规则实现任务执行,面对动态业务场景时存在扩展性差、维护成本高等痛点。新一代AI任务执行框架通过引入智能决策引擎、动态任务编排和跨系统集成能力,构建起”感知-决策-执行-反馈”的完整闭环。
以某主流开源框架为例,其技术架构包含四层核心模块:
- 任务解析层:支持自然语言指令解析与结构化任务拆解
- 决策引擎层:集成规则引擎与机器学习模型实现动态决策
- 执行器层:提供跨平台API调用、脚本执行、界面操作等能力
- 反馈优化层:通过执行日志分析持续优化任务执行策略
这种架构设计使开发者能够通过配置化方式快速构建复杂任务流。例如在电商场景中,系统可自动解析”处理今日所有退款申请”的指令,拆解为数据查询、条件判断、系统调用等子任务,最终完成从业务受理到资金退还的全流程自动化。
二、典型落地场景与技术实现方案
场景1:自动化运维与故障自愈
某金融企业通过构建智能运维助手,将平均故障恢复时间(MTTR)降低65%。系统核心实现包含:
- 指令解析模块:使用BERT模型训练运维领域专用NLP模型,准确识别”检查数据库连接池状态”等指令
- 任务编排引擎:基于DAG图实现任务依赖管理,支持并发执行与异常回滚
- 执行插件系统:集成SSH、Kubernetes API、Prometheus查询等20+种执行方式
# 示例:数据库健康检查任务编排def db_health_check():tasks = [{"type": "ssh", "command": "netstat -tulnp | grep mysql"},{"type": "api", "url": "http://prometheus:9090/api/v1/query","params": {"query": "mysql_global_status_threads_connected"}},{"type": "script", "path": "/scripts/check_slow_queries.sh"}]return execute_task_graph(tasks)
场景2:数据处理流水线构建
在医疗影像分析场景中,系统需要完成从数据采集到模型推理的全流程自动化。关键技术实现包括:
- 多模态指令理解:支持”处理CT影像并生成诊断报告”等复合指令
- 动态资源调度:根据任务优先级自动分配GPU计算资源
- 结果验证机制:通过交叉验证确保处理结果的准确性
# 数据处理任务配置示例task_flow:- name: data_ingestiontype: s3_syncparams:bucket: medical-imagesprefix: CT/2023-10/- name: preprocessingtype: dicom_convertdepends_on: data_ingestion- name: model_inferencetype: tensorflow_servingresources:gpu: 1depends_on: preprocessing
场景3:智能业务决策支持
某零售企业构建的促销策略生成系统,通过分析历史销售数据自动生成最优促销方案。系统包含:
- 数据增强模块:整合天气、节假日等外部数据源
- 策略模拟引擎:使用蒙特卡洛方法评估不同策略效果
- 决策可视化:通过交互式仪表盘展示策略建议依据
三、前沿技术挑战与解决方案
挑战1:复杂场景下的长任务执行
对于需要数小时甚至数天完成的长时间任务,系统需解决:
- 状态持久化:采用检查点机制定期保存任务状态
- 异常恢复:通过任务快照实现断点续传
- 进度追踪:集成分布式追踪系统实现全链路监控
挑战2:多智能体协同工作
在大型项目中,单个智能体难以处理所有子任务。解决方案包括:
- 技能图谱构建:定义智能体能力模型与协作接口
- 任务分配算法:基于强化学习实现动态任务分配
- 通信协议标准化:定义跨智能体消息格式与交换机制
// 智能体通信协议示例message AgentMessage {string sender_id = 1;string receiver_id = 2;enum MessageType {TASK_REQUEST = 0;TASK_RESPONSE = 1;STATUS_UPDATE = 2;}MessageType type = 3;google.protobuf.Any payload = 4;}
挑战3:安全合规性要求
在金融、医疗等受监管行业,系统需满足:
- 数据脱敏处理:在任务执行过程中自动识别敏感信息
- 操作审计追踪:完整记录所有系统操作行为
- 权限精细控制:基于RBAC模型实现最小权限原则
四、技术选型建议与实施路径
对于计划引入AI任务执行框架的企业,建议采用三阶段实施路径:
-
基础建设期(1-3个月):完成框架选型与基础能力建设
- 评估开源框架成熟度与社区活跃度
- 构建基础任务模板库
- 实现与现有系统的API集成
-
场景拓展期(3-6个月):在核心业务场景落地
- 选择2-3个高价值场景进行试点
- 建立任务开发标准流程
- 构建监控告警体系
-
能力深化期(6-12个月):向智能化方向演进
- 引入强化学习优化决策策略
- 实现多智能体协同
- 构建任务市场促进能力复用
在技术选型方面,建议重点关注以下能力:
- 低代码开发支持:通过可视化界面降低使用门槛
- 插件化架构:便于扩展新的执行方式
- 跨平台兼容性:支持Windows/Linux/macOS多环境
- 企业级特性:包括高可用、灾备、权限管理等
五、未来发展趋势展望
随着大模型技术的突破,AI任务执行框架将向以下方向发展:
- 意图理解升级:从关键词匹配到上下文感知的完整意图解析
- 自主进化能力:通过持续学习自动优化任务执行策略
- 多模态交互:支持语音、手势等新型交互方式
- 边缘计算集成:在物联网设备端实现轻量化任务执行
某研究机构预测,到2026年,采用智能任务执行框架的企业将实现30%以上的运营效率提升。对于开发者而言,掌握这类框架的开发技能将成为未来职业发展的重要竞争力。建议从理解基础架构开始,通过实际项目积累经验,逐步向架构设计、性能优化等高级领域拓展。